Location : 63 kms from Jammu
Area Covered : 400 sq kms
Attraction : Himalayan Black Deer, Himalayan Brown Deer, Musk Deer
Best Time to Visit : September to March for Mammal Viewing
Kishtwar National Park is a high altitude park which is located in Jammu Region of Jammu & Kashmir. The National Park is widely spread with an area of around 400 sq kms. The people are attracted towards the park because of the 15 different, rare and dangerous species found here that includes the Musk deer, Himalayan Black and Brown Bear, Markhor, Langur, Hangul and Leopard. The best time to view these mammals is from the month of September to March
Avifauna :
There are around 50 spices of birds here in this park and among them the main species are the Himalayan Jungle Crow, Bearded Vulture, Griffon Vulture, Golden Oriole, White Cheeked Bulbul, Paradise Flycatcher and Indian Mynah.
Flora :
The altitude and climate of the sanctuary is the reason because of which the vegetation of different type occurs here.Some of the most important species are Cedrus Deodara, Pinus Wall chiana, Pinus Gerardiana, Juglans Regia, etc.The shrubs which cover the most of the area are Desmodium Tilliaefolium and Parrotiopsis Jacquemontiana. The hubs which grow here major are Artemisia Vulgaris, Dipsacus Mitis, etc
